Understanding Peppermint Oil as a Rodent Repellent

where to buy peppermint oil for mice

Peppermint oil is a natural way to keep mice and other rodents away. It works by emitting a strong and pleasant scent that mice find overwhelming and unpleasant. When mice encounter the scent of peppermint oil, they are likely to avoid the area altogether.

One very important thing to remember when you use peppermint oil to keep mice away is that it must be 100% pure peppermint oil. Other oils or products that claim to contain peppermint may not be effective, as they may contain only small amounts of the active ingredient.

Black pepper, on the other hand, is not an effective mouse repellent. While it may have a strong smell, it does not have the same overwhelming effect on mice that peppermint oil does.

Peppermint candy may also not be effective in repelling mice. While it may contain peppermint oil, the concentration is likely too low to have a significant effect on mice.

Mice won't come near places where peppermint oil is on cotton balls. Put them near doors or windows or other places mice are likely to go. To keep the scent going, change the cotton balls every couple of days.

Overall, peppermint oil is a safe and natural way to repel mice from your home. By using 100% pure peppermint oil and placing it strategically, you can effectively keep mice at bay without the use of harmful chemicals or traps.

Application Tips for Peppermint Oil

100 peppermint oil for mice

Effective Placement

When using concentrated peppermint oil for mice, it is important to place the oil in areas where mice are likely to be present. This includes areas where mice have been spotted, as well as areas where mice are likely to enter the building, such as near doors and windows.

One way that works is to put a few drops of peppermint oil on cotton balls and place them in key places. It's okay to put them behind appliances, under sinks, and in room corners. You could also use a spray bottle to put peppermint oil in places where mice are likely to be.

Safety Precautions

While peppermint oil is generally considered safe, it is important to take certain precautions when using it. Children and pets should not be able to get to concentrated peppermint oil for mice. It should also not be eaten.

It is also important to use peppermint oil in a well-ventilated area, as the strong scent can be overwhelming in enclosed spaces. Additionally, it is important to avoid getting peppermint oil in the eyes or on the skin, as it can cause irritation.

Overall, when used correctly, peppermint oil can be an effective and natural way to repel mice. By following these application tips and safety precautions, individuals can use peppermint oil to effectively keep mice out of their homes or buildings.

Peppermint Oil in Different Settings

black pepper and mice

Household Use

Peppermint oil is often used as a natural way to keep mice out of homes. It smells good and is safe to use around kids and pets.Peppermint oil can get rid of mice in your house. Just put a few drops of the oil on cotton balls and put them in places where mice like to hang out, like corner, near doors and windows, and in cabinets. You could clean the house with a spray bottle full of peppermint oil and water.

In Vehicles

Mice can also be a problem in vehicles, especially during the winter months when they seek shelter from the cold. Peppermint oil for mice in car can be used to repel mice in cars, trucks, and RVs.Using peppermint oil to get rid of mice in your car is easy. Just put a few drops on cotton balls and put them in places mice like to go, like the engine compartment, the trunk, and under the seats.

Outdoor Areas

Outside, in places like gardens, patios, and sheds, peppermint oil can also be used to keep mice away. If you want to get rid of mice outside with peppermint oil, mix it with water in a spray bottle and spray it around the area's edges. You could also put cotton balls with a few drops of essential oil on them and place them in places mice are likely to go, like near doors and windows.

Peppermint oil is a versatile and effective natural remedy to repel mice in different settings. By using it properly, homeowners can keep their houses, cars, and outdoor areas free of mice without using harmful chemicals.

Maintaining a Mouse-Free Environment

Keeping mice out of your home requires more than just using peppermint oil. Here are some additional steps you can take to maintain a mouse-free environment:

  • Seal all entry points: Mice can get in through very small holes, so make sure that your home's foundation, walls, and roof are all sealed up. Fill in any holes with caulk, steel wool, or something else.
  • Keep food stored properly:Mice are drawn to food, so keep all of your food in containers that can't be opened. Keep your kitchen clean and don't leave food out overnight.
  • Clear out your space:  Mice like to hide in a lot of stuff, so keep your home neat and clean. Get rid of any unnecessary clutter and keep storage areas organized.
  • Use traps: Traps can be an effective way to catch mice. Put snap traps or live traps in places where you've seen mice move around.
  • Use repellents: In addition to peppermint oil, there are other natural repellents that can help keep mice away. Try using essential oils like eucalyptus, lavender, or citronella.

By following these steps, you can help prevent mice from entering your home and keep your living space clean and mouse-free.Don't forget that you should use more than one method for the best results.
